Water treatment fields are continuously seeking innovative solutions to enhance water purification. Nanobubble technology has emerged as a promising advancement in this domain, offering exceptional results in removing contaminants. These minuscule bubbles, with diameters ranging from 1 to 100 nanometers, possess increased surface areas and absorption capabilities. This allows them to effectively target a wide range of pollutants, including chemical contaminants, heavy metals, and pathogens.
- Additionally, nanobubbles produce reactive oxygen species (ROS), which effectively break down harmful substances. This holistic approach to water treatment offers numerous perks over conventional methods, such as minimized energy consumption, improved efficiency, and minimal impact on the environment.
As a result, nanobubble technology is altering the landscape of water treatment. Its adaptability makes it suitable for a diverse range of applications, including municipal water treatment, industrial wastewater management, and farming irrigation. Nano bubble generators are revolutionizing various industries by creating microscopic bubbles that possess remarkable properties. These tiny bubbles, typically ranging from 1 to 100 nanometers in diameter, demonstrate unique physical and chemical characteristics compared to their larger counterparts. Produced through a variety of methods, nano bubbles present a wide range of applications, including enhanced mass transfer, improved disinfection, and increased saturation.
The smaller size of nano bubbles leads to a significantly larger surface area to volume ratio. This amplified surface area boosts their ability to interact with substances, facilitating processes such as dissolution. In agriculture, nano bubbles can boost nutrient uptake by plants, promoting development. In wastewater treatment, they effectively eliminate pollutants by increasing the transfer of oxygen and other chemicals.
